About Pablo Rivas

Pablo Rivas is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ition, Signal Processing, Infectious Diseases and Computer Networks and Communications, having authored 127 papers that have together received 1.8k indexed citations. Recurring topics across this work include Adversarial Robustness in Machine Learning (12 papers), Quantum Information and Cryptography (11 papers), Quantum Computing Algorithms and Architecture (11 papers), Face and Expression Recognition (8 papers), Topic Modeling (8 papers), Ethics and Social Impacts of AI (8 papers), HIV/AIDS drug development and treatment (6 papers) and HIV Research and Treatment (6 papers). The work is most often cited by research in Health Informatics (75 citations), Hepatology (174 citations), Virology (98 citations), Infectious Diseases (346 citations) and Emergency Medicine (135 citations). Pablo Rivas has collaborated with scholars based in United States, Spain and Mexico. Frequent co-authors include Vincent Soriano, Pablo Barreiro, Luz Martín‐Carbonero, Miguel Górgolas, Sonia Rodríguez‐Nóvoa, Pablo Labarga, Javier Orduz, Ernesto Sifuentes, J. Medraño and Eugenia Vispo. Their work appears in journals such as AIDS Research and Human Retroviruses, International Journal of Machine Learning and Cybernetics, American Journal of Tropical Medicine and Hygiene, JAIDS Journal of Acquired Immune Deficiency Syndromes and HIV Clinical Trials.
